NO: Good Car: The All New HONDA CR-V 2007

This is a bit of an advertisement script on the car of my choice, the all new HONDA CR-V 2007.

The 3rd Generation of HONDA SUV has finally reached our shore on 8th March, 2007. CR-V has been so successful in our local market since its first introduction to Malaysia in 1996. On the launching day, I rushed to the showroom trying to be the few first to witness its new look.

“WOW” my first impression is good. For the past 2 generation, the only set back from my opinion was its conservative outlook but now no more. What most impressed me of this new model is its new aerodynamics design. According the HONDA, they claimed to be the best among all SUVs in the current market. Wider wheel arches, gently sloping lines and bold chrome grill create harmony in apparent contradictions. a lower centre of gravity. The interior design is trendy, having the gear shift integrated centre panel, luxurious feel, 20 storage areas and great looking dashboard.

Also, despite of its undisputable performance and reliability, CR-V was always lacked in accessories. Not anymore. New model equipped with loads of standard accessories and features which one could think of such as the automatically lit up instrument panel, the multi-functioning tilt telescopic steering wheel with Electric Powered Steering (EPS), Vehicle Information Display (VID), integrated audio system with 6 CD changer, dual zone Air-conditioning, steering wheel audio and cruise control, multi-functioning adjustable rear seats and many more. They also claimed to have greater use of sound insulation and sound absorption material to create a more quiet environment cabin which is also a welcome (I personally agreed that HONDA’s sound insulation is always lacking behind.).

For the power plant, a newly design 2.0 iVTEC engine is in place, giving out 150ps (110kw) @ 6,200 rpm of maximum power output and 190Nm @ 4,200rpm of maximum Torque. Just the same with previous model but improved, a Real-time 4WD system is incorporated.

For the safety, 2 front Airbags, diagonal dual circuit braking system, ABS, active headrest and G-CON body are included as current standard in Malaysia market.

All the above feature and specification comes together with a price tag of RM147,800.00 which is slightly increased from the previous model but I think is worth every penny you spend. For more detail, readers could visit their website at Honda Malaysia.
